Basic Rentals, Descriptions, Cabins are knotty pine with gas log fireplaces, fully furnished and decorated with full amenities and kitchens. Most include river views, yards, ponds, decks, screened porches, carports, shed and average 150 feet apart and include use of other facilities. | ||||||

Basic Rentals: Considering the unseen/untried character of presentations over the internet distances making it impractical to visit prior to renting, and thereafter the unforeseen, although as a retreat renting term-wise, we feel ethically obligated to provide the following flexible initial period. | ||||||
|
Therefore... if after arriving having stayed only 2 nights in a cabin the pre-paid reserve deposit of $120 would be exchanged for full rent for the stay without further cost or obligation ( $75 for a "Treehouse/Unusual Dwelling" ... $36 for an RV site w/full hook-ups ) ... the reserved deposit applied as rent for early departure being equal to ½ the normal cost of $240 for the first two weeks. For further assurance of satisfaction and fair exchange, having stayed beyond the initial 3 nights see: Contingency Policy. Continuing your stay ... Having stayed the first two weeks the mid-month balance of $240 for the remaining two weeks would be due unless having vacated. The amount paid in two equal payments for a full amenity cabin including utilities having stayed the full month/term would therefore total $480. ( Unusual Structures: $300, RV Sites: $236 ) ... Reserve Deposit Required ... ... and must be received far enough in advance to process, confirm & transfer. Reserve deposit applicable to rent. Refundable Security Deposit Required after Two Weeks of the initial monthly term, a refundable general cleaning, etc., deposit of ½ the rent is required. If the general security deposit is not received within above stated time frame, the rental is automatically terminated w/out refund of rent paid for the balance of the term. All stated rates are for a term of one month with option of renewal if offered by owner. Rent includes (rentals with full amenities) electricity and propane, (utilities included only during the 1st month with the option of continuing by owner or transfer to renter by same a reasonable discount). Lodge available May through October only. Rates Include . . . Initial courtesy use items/supplies and garbage removal provided up to two weeks (garbage must be separated prior to removal i.e. paper, bottles, cans, etc.). Thereafter responsibility of renter. Transfer station on the way to town one & a half miles. | ||||||
